Leigh Ann Boyd, Regent Ocoee Chapter, NSDAR presents David Jeffers – Pres. of Scott County Historical Society with a book titled Patriots to Pioneers – The first Tennessee Volunteers. The Scott County Historical Society offered coffee and donuts during the special event.

AllAttachments (15 50th Anniversary Celebration of Oneida City Park Oneida City Park celebrated their 50th anniversary this past Labor Day, Monday, September 2, 2024 with live entertainment, food trucks, birthday cake, and an end-of-summer fireworks show. Entertainment included Anthony Smith, the Clint Keeton Band, Headover Hills and the Skene Valley Band.

The Oneida High School Class of 1969 held its 55th year reunion Saturday, August 24, at Timber Rock Lodge.
